Well-known Jesuit composer Fr Christopher Willcock SJ has written a mass to commemorate the ANZAC Centenary, 2014 to 2018 in Australia. He has made the music for the Mass for the Fallen available free online. ANZAC Day marks the first major military action fought by the Australian and New Zealand Army Corps (ANZAC) in World War 1. The mass is for ANZAC Day, April 25, this year, but Fr Willcock hopes it will be performed for ANZAC Days in the future as well.
A motet from the Mass for the Fallen entitled “We will remember them” is in the ANZAC tribute album, Gallipoli. “We will remember them” can also be downloaded free.
